WebA Dutch angle or Dutch tilt is a great way to introduce diagonal leading lines into your image but just keep in mind that it can quickly become quite tired. It can be a fun way of shooting buildings (though it tends to become less pronounced the more you get low and lookup), but if you’re shooting people, it can be distracting and unsettling. WebNov 12, 2024 · The Dutch angle is a camera shot that involves a noticeable tilt compared to the horizon. It's also often referred to as a Dutch tilt, canted angle, oblique angle, or … In cinematography, the Dutch angle is one of many cinematic techniques often used to portray psychological uneasiness or tension in the subject being filmed. The Dutch tilt is strongly associated with the German movie scene during the expressionist movement, which used the Dutch angle extensively.
